Output 53391a6f83814d25b3c9624c97e11abb65fc4cce4867cd440fd9de6bcbf2f72f:0

value
10855336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575f5be6316f448c3d759a3e8011a9460e1b39b9 OP_EQUAL
address
39ezwte9oRfn2fBkvbiVmGLmuoeSBJE7v7
transaction
53391a6f83814d25b3c9624c97e11abb65fc4cce4867cd440fd9de6bcbf2f72f
spent
true